FAQ

What is the Certificate in Personal and Organizational Leadership?
This is a program designed to provide a structured means for students from across the University to learn more about leadership and develop their own leadership skills, while earning University credit towards a certificate.

Do I need a specific major to be eligible for the Certificate Program?
No - the Certificate Program is open to all students across the University.

Do I need any number of hours to qualify for the Program?
Yes - you should be a rising Junior. A good way to test yourself on this is to ask if you are on track to graduate by Spring or Summer in 2 years. Rising Seniors may apply if their schedule allows them to complete all the course work in 1 year, for example 4100 and 5000 are offered in Fall and 5100 in Spring.

Do I need to apply to each program separately?
No, - Scholar and certificate programs have online applications available on each web page. If you meet the criteria, you may apply to both programs simultaneously, but will ultimately be accepted into only one program.

What are the criteria for acceptance?
The Certificate Program is designed to develop and cultivate leadership abilities in students from any major at UGA. Evidence of academic accomplishment is important; thus, students with GPAs below 3.2 will not be considered. Applications unfortunately exceed the number of slots available; therefore, students are chosen based on demonstrated leadership experience, academic achievement, community service, involvement at UGA, and a review of the overall application.

How is the Certificate program different from the Leadership Scholars program?
The main differences are: (1) The LLSP is open only to Terry undergraduates; certificate is open to all UGA undergraduates. (2) The LLSP involves a 2-year commitment and its activities make greater demands on your time; the certificate program can be completed in one year and has no extracurricular demands.

Am I eligible for a Certificate if I have applied to the Leadership Scholars Program?
Yes, by fulfilling the course requirements of the certificate.

What is required to complete the Certificate?
The requirements are outlined on the Undergraduate Certificate home page. Briefly though, there are 3 courses that are mandatory (7 hours total). There is also a menu of elective courses, from which you must take 9 hours; and signing of a commitment contract.

How will the Certificate courses count towards my degree requirements?
This depends upon your major. At a minimum though, all of the courses should count as institutional option electives towards your major. Moreover, if your major requires courses that are on the elective menu, you may apply one such course towards satisfaction of the Certificate's elective requirement.

Is there a fee to enter the certificate program?
No, the cost of the program is underwritten by private donations.
